A rectangle has coordinates A(-4, 3), B(0, 0), C(6, 8), D(2, 11). What is the area of the rectangle?
asambeis [7]

Any polygon given by a list of 2D vertex coordinates has area given by the shoelace formula.

That's the absolute value of half the sum of the cross products of the sides.  We form the table of the vertices. We include the first vertex at the end, then calculate the cross product of the side, (a,b) then (c,d) gives cross product ad-bc.

         cross product

-4 3  0

0 0   0

6 8    6(11)-8(2) = 66 - 16 = 50

2 11   2(3) - (11)(-4) = 50

-4 3

So the area is (1/2)(50+50) = 50

Answer: 50

This is the first step in which construction?
slavikrds [6]

Answer:

Option A is correct.

Step-by-step explanation:

The first step in the construction of a square inscribed in a circle is to draw a diameter of the circle.

Then we have to draw perpendicular bisector of the diameter using a compass.

Therefore, the perpendicular bisector will be another diameter of the circle and both the diameters will meet at the center of the circle.

Now, join the points with straight lines in order where the two diameters meet the circle. And finally, we will get a square inscribed in the circle.

Hence, option A is correct. (Answer)
